The Colourful Market © Tonga Visitors Bureau Tonga's waterfront capital of Nuku'alofa is the kingdom's centre of government and home to the Royal Palace – the official residence of Tonga's current monarch, King George Tupou V. Many of the Nuku'alofa's wooden colonial buildings date from the Victorian era, including the fine palace – Tonga's most photographed icon. The hub of Nuku'alofa is the busy waterfront strip, with its magnificent views of the outer islands of the Tongatapu Group, while the colourful Traditional Handcrafts © Tonga Visitors BureauTalamahu Market is an ideal place to sample the local produce and shop for traditional handcrafts.

Nuku'alofa is easy to explore on foot, and you'll find an eclectic range of activities, shops, banks, travel agents, restaurants, hotels, cafes, clubs and bars. In the evenings, the nightclubs in Nuku'alofa stay open till the small hours except on Saturdays, when clubs wind up at midnight (Sunday is a day of rest). Pangaimotu, Fafa and Royal Sunset all have resorts, beach activities, cafes and restaurants, and make a lovely day trip. Other attractions beyond Nuku'alofa include the Tongan National Centre and the dramatic blowholes near Houma.
